Our team has helped countless people lead healthier lives by reducing the burden of living with chronic disease. Our functional medicine program focuses on lifestyle influences, genetics, and the environment to determine what is causing your disease or chronic conditions.
A caregiver in this position works Monday through Friday, 8:00am to 5:00pm with no weekends or holidays required.
A caregiver who excels in this role will:
-
Ensure compliance with policies, procedures, regulatory standards and handling human resource issues.
-
Participate as a CHN management team member to assist in long-range planning.
-
Carry out strategic clinical nutrition initiatives for the health system.
-
Supervise assigned personnel including Registered Dietitians, Dietetic Technicians, and Clinical Assistants
Minimum qualifications for the ideal future caregiver include:
-
Master's degree in nutrition, dietetics, or related field.
-
Completion of an Academy Nutrition and Dietetics-approved dietetic internship (or equivalent dietitian-qualifying experience) and current certification as a registered dietitian (RD).
-
Current license to practice dietetics in the State of Ohio (LD).
-
Three years of experience as a practicing dietitian in a clinical setting.
-
Two years of supervisory/leadership experience with proven ability to lead the work of others.
Physical Requirements:
- A high degree of dexterity to produce materials on a PC; normal or corrected vision to normal range; extensive sitting and frequent walking; occasional lifting or carrying 5 to 15 pounds.
